Responsibilities
Financial Management and Operations:
- Prepare, review, and present mon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and regulatory standards.
- Develop and manage detailed budgets and forecasts, collaborating with key departments to ensure production targets and financial objectives are met.
- Monitor and analyze production costs to identify inefficiencies and maximize profitability, providing actionable insights to optimize operations.
- Oversee accounts payable, receivables, payroll, and employee reimbursements, ensuring timely and accurate processing of all financial transactions.
- Conduct regular bank reconciliations, closely monitor cash flow, and maintain an up-to-date record of daily financial transactions to ensure accurate reporting.
- Provide financial expertise and oversight in procurement and expense management, conducting rigorous financial checks to ensure compliance and preserve the integrity of financial data.
Compliance and Reporting:
- Ensure full compliance with tax regulations and financial laws, staying up-to-date on changes to maintain the company’s legal and financial standing.
- Develop, implement, and periodically review financial policies and procedures to strengthen internal controls and promote operational efficiency.
- Ensure strict adherence to accounting standards, maintaining transparency and accuracy in financial reporting in accordance with IFRS.
- Provide regular, detailed updates on financial performance, highlighting key risks and opportunities to inform strategic decision-making.
- Report directly to the Managing Director, delivering concise and insightful financial reports to guide executive-level decisions.
